Oil City is 0-10 against Franklin since October of 2018 but things could change on Tuesday. The Oil City Oilers will be staying on the road to face off against the Franklin Knights at 6:00 p.m. Considering both teams were shutout in their prior games, the pair is probably coming into this one with something to prove.
Oil City's offense might be in the hot seat on Tuesday considering what happened against Meadville on Wednesday. They came up short against the Bulldogs, falling 11-0. While losing is never fun, the Oilers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Pennsylvania soccer rankings (they are ranked 550th, while the Bulldogs are ranked 176th).
Meanwhile, Franklin was not able to break out of their rough patch on Monday as the team picked up their third straight loss. They lost 10-0 to Warren.
Oil City's defeat dropped their record down to 0-7. As for Franklin, their loss dropped their record down to 2-6.
Oil City might still be hurting after the 10-0 defeat they got from Franklin in their previous matchup back in August. Can Oil City av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
